/// <summary> /// Betölti a user objektumba a választható költséghelyek listáját. /// </summary> /// <param name="user"></param> /// <param name="db"></param> private static void LoadAssignableCostPlaces(User user, MobilePhoneAdministrationContext db) { var costPlaces = new List <CostPlace>(); costPlaces = db.CostPlaces.ToList(); user.AssignableCostPlaces = new SelectList(costPlaces, "Id", "CostCodeAndName"); }
/// <summary> /// Betölti a választható szerződéskategóriákat paraméterben megadott SIMCard objektum az AssignableContractCategories property-be /// </summary> /// <param name="user"></param> /// <param name="db"></param> private static void LoadAssignableContractCategories(SIMCard sIMCard, MobilePhoneAdministrationContext db) { var contractCategories = new List <ContractCategory>(); contractCategories = db.ContractCategories.ToList(); sIMCard.AssignableContractCategories = new SelectList(contractCategories, "Id", "Name"); }